
Whether you live in a climate with cold winter weather or you are planning a ski trip up north, winter can be a challenge if you suffer from dry eyes. Dry, cool air, cold winds, and even drier indoor heating can cause eye irritation, burning, itching, and redness, and sometimes even excessively watery eyes as more tears are produced to compensate for the dryness. Many people have a chronic feeling that they have something in their eye, and some even experience blurred vision. These symptoms can be debilitating!
Dry eyes is one of the most common complaints eye doctors get from patients during the winter season, especially in cooler climates. That’s why we’d like to share some tips on how to relieve dry eye discomfort, and how to know when your condition is serious enough to come in for an evaluation.

Dry eye syndrome is a chronic condition in which the eyes do not produce enough tear film or do not produce the quality of tear film needed to keep the eyes moist. While winter weather can make this condition worse, it is often present all year round.
